package tuf import ( "io" "os" "path/filepath" ) type MockTufClient struct { srcPath string dstPath string } func NewMockTufClient(srcPath string, dstPath string) *MockTufClient { if srcPath == "" { panic("srcPath must be set") } if dstPath == "" { panic("dstPath must be set") } return &MockTufClient{ srcPath: srcPath, dstPath: dstPath, } } func (dc *MockTufClient) DownloadTarget(target string, filePath string) (actualFilePath string, data []byte, err error) { src, err := os.Open(filepath.Join(dc.srcPath, target)) if err != nil { return "", nil, err } defer src.Close() var dstFilePath string if filePath == "" { dstFilePath = filepath.Join(dc.dstPath, filepath.FromSlash(target)) } else { dstFilePath = filePath } err = os.MkdirAll(filepath.Dir(dstFilePath), os.ModePerm) if err != nil { return "", nil, err } dst, err := os.Create(dstFilePath) if err != nil { return "", nil, err } defer dst.Close() // reading from tee will read from src and write to dst at the same time tee := io.TeeReader(src, dst) b, err := io.ReadAll(tee) if err != nil { return "", nil, err } return dstFilePath, b, nil } type MockVersionChecker struct { err error } func NewMockVersionChecker() *MockVersionChecker { return &MockVersionChecker{} } func (vc *MockVersionChecker) CheckVersion(_ Downloader) error { return vc.err }
